本篇文章给大家谈谈c语言编程牛顿插值,以及c语言牛顿插值法简单编程对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、高分悬赏——数值逼近的c语言编程题。题目有关插值知识,数学系高材生...
- 2、用C语言对X^3+10X-20=0求解
- 3、牛顿的插值法用C语言怎么编写怎么编啊?
- 4、求用c语言编写牛顿插值法
- 5、C语言编写牛顿插值多项式
高分悬赏——数值逼近的c语言编程题。题目有关插值知识,数学系高材生...
编写程序,输入一个正整数n(1n=10),在输入n个整数,将最小值与第一个数交换,最大值与最后一个数交换,然后输出交换后的n个数。
同理可以计算32位整型的情况。如果超出了这个范围比如128,有的编译器处理的方式就是 -12类似于一个环,129存储成 -127,long也是这个规律。但是c语言只保证long不小于int,32位机器上long也是32位的跟整型是一样的。
在C语言中,输入和输出是经由标准库中的一组函数来实现的。在ANSI C中,这些函数被定义在头文件;中。
从键盘上输入若干字符,直到输入’#”结束。统计英文字母、数字、空格、其他字符的个数并输出。
粗略地看Verilog与C语言有许多相似之处。分号用于结束每个语句,注释符也是相同的(/* ... */和// 都是熟悉的),运算符“==”也用来测试相等性。
要输入的分数太多,我懒得手数,用2位随机数代替手输入,输入函数我单独写了,你需要调用就行了,详细看备注。
用C语言对X^3+10X-20=0求解
对于方程x^3 - 3x - 1 = 0,可以将其转化为x = (x^3 - 1) / 3。因此,可以使用迭代公式x = (xxx - 1) / 3来不断逼近方程的解。
牛顿的插值法用C语言怎么编写怎么编啊?
printf(%f,x1);} 牛顿迭代法:牛顿迭代法(Newtons method)又称为牛顿-拉弗森方法(Newton-Raphson method),它是一种在实数域和复数域上近似求解方程的方法。方法使用函数的泰勒级数的前面几项来寻找方程的根。
是用C语言编写程序,来实现拉格朗日插值法。
已知 n 个点 x,y; x 必须已按顺序排好。要插值 ni 点,横坐标 xi[], 输出 yi[]。程序里用double 型,保证计算精度。SPL调用现成的程序。现成的程序很多。端点处理方法不同,结果会有不同。
求用c语言编写牛顿插值法
return x0; //若返回x0和x1的平均值则更佳 } 例2:用牛顿迭代法求方程x^2 - 5x + 6 = 0,要求精确到10E-6。
C语言编写牛顿插值多项式
牛顿插值多项式:(x0,f(x0),(x1,f(x1),(x2,f(x2),……,(xn,f(xn)。牛顿插值法相对于拉格朗日插值法具有承袭性的优势,即在增加额外的插值点时,可以利用之前的运算结果以降低运算量。
牛顿插值法的插值估计:使用构造的多项式函数,可以估计在任意一点的取值。这个估计值与实际值之间的误差通常会小于给定的误差范围。
因此,拉格朗日型二次插值多项式为:L_2(x)=1-0.6321x+0.3679x^2 牛顿型二次插值多项式为:N_2(x)=1-0.6321x+0.3679x(x-1)然后,我们可以使用二阶 Taylor 公式来估算插值多项式的误差。
为了解决这个问题,我们可以***用分段插值的方法,将整个区间分成若干个子区间,然后在每个子区间内分别插值计算。这样可以减少计算量,提高计算效率。牛顿插值公式的基本思想是通过已知的数据点构造一个多项式函数。
c语言编程牛顿插值的介绍就聊到这里吧,感谢你花[_a***_]阅读本站内容,更多关于c语言牛顿插值法简单编程、c语言编程牛顿插值的信息别忘了在本站进行查找喔。